Lead, Zinc, Cadmium and Copper levels in Almendares river, Havana City, Cuba
The objective of this study was to assess the levels of Pb, Cu, Zn and Cd in Almendares River (Havana City, Cuba). Fifteen sampling stations were located along the river. | Sumario: | The objective of this study was to assess the levels of Pb, Cu, Zn and Cd in Almendares River (Havana City, Cuba). Fifteen sampling stations were located along the river. The concentrations of these metals were determined in the sediments and the roots of Eichhornia crassipes during the dry season of 2003 and 2004.
